Cave Canem Brings the Drama
Annual Benefit Performance
October 24, 2011

Suzzanne Douglas performing selections from May Joseph's Fled, Tracie Morris performing selections from Claudia Rankine and Casey Llewellyn's Existing Condisitions, Lili taylor Performing a monologue from Jessica Hagedorn's Stairway to Heaven, Samantha Maurice and John Douglas Thompson performing selections from Cornelius Eady's Brutal Imagination.

  Directed by Ted Sod
  Mahogany Browne Emcees
